2009 Dodge Journey vs. 2006 Mazda RX-8

To start off, 2009 Dodge Journey is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2006 Mazda RX-8.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2006 Mazda RX-8 would be higher. At 1,968 cc (4 cylinders), 2009 Dodge Journey is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Mazda RX-8 (190 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 52 more horse power than 2009 Dodge Journey. (138 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Mazda RX-8 should accelerate faster than 2009 Dodge Journey.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Dodge Journey weights approximately 340 kg more than 2006 Mazda RX-8.

Because 2006 Mazda RX-8 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2006 Mazda RX-8.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Dodge Journey,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Dodge Journey (310 Nm @ 1750 RPM) has 90 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Mazda RX-8. (220 Nm @ 5000 RPM). This means 2009 Dodge Journey will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Mazda RX-8.
